Aug. 8th, 2007 11:36 amTiered front slit skirt, made out of dyed bits of silk and misc bits of other fabrics.

The slit goes to slightly above the knee.
Tiers are as follows going from the bottom up:
Sea green taffeta silk dyed black making it a mottled bluish purple. Raw ripped hem.
Yellow paisley jaquard silk dyed black. Bias cut (was an old night gown) serged bead hem edge.
Black netting
Black chiffon. Raw ripped hem
Unstretchy black fishnet size netting.
And more black chiffon with a raw hem.
Base fabric for the skirt is a plain black lining material.
I did a little experimenting with this one with a hidden elastic waist. The top layer having been sewn to the inside then flipped over the waist band and then tacked down every 2" or so to the waist band.
We'll see how it works out when it's worn for a long period of time. Thus far preliminary wears have been successful with the elastic not turning, but it does make it slightly confusing when you're putting it on.
